History

The Modeford is one of the few modern buildings in this historic part of Stanbury, and its colourful frontage was designed to attract attention to the achingly hip advertising agency inside, Modeford a la Mode. From the mid-90s to the outbreak, the Modeford was the place for Stanbury's fixie-riding, iPhone-toting, espresso-sipping hipsters to congregate and conform to each other while pretending to earn a living.

Since the Malton Incident, hipsters continue to meet up regularly, and maintain their parasitic lifestyle of picking other people's brains because they have no life or soul of their own.
